  15. News -

    In February 2023, Kent and Medway ICB and Kent and Medway NHS and Social Care Partnership Trust (KMPT) launched a public consultation on Health Based Places of Safety. These are the facilities KMPT provides for adults needing emergency care and assessment under Section 136 of the Mental Health Act.
